Member RANDOMSTRG in CGICBLDEV2 / HTMLEXAMPL

1.00 
 /$top
2.00 
 Content-type: text/html
3.00 
 expires: 0
4.00 
 
5.00 
 <HTML>
6.00 
 <HEAD>
7.00 
 <TITLE>Example of using subprocedure QRANDOMSTRING</title>
8.00 
 <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
9.00 
 
10.00 
 <style type="text/css">
11.00 
    <!--
12.00 
 .title { color: blue; font-weight: bold; font-size: 24pt; font-family: souvenir lt bt, verdana, serif; align: center}
13.00 
 .subtitle { color: black; font-weight: bold; font-size: 12pt; font-family: souvenir lt bt, verdana, serif; align: center}
14.00 
 .reg {font-size: 10pt; font-family: arial, helvetica, helv}
15.00 
 .boldtitle { font-family:  Arial Black, Arial, sans-serif; font-weight: Helvetica Black, bold; font-size: 24px; }
16.00 
 .mono { font-family: courier; font-size: 10pt; }
17.00 
 td,th,caption { font-family: Arial, sans-serif; font-size: 10pt; }
18.00 
 pre { font-family: monospace; font-weight: normal; font-size: 10pt; }
19.00 
    -->
20.00 
 </style>
21.00 
 </HEAD>
22.00 
 
23.00 
 <BODY TEXT="black" LINK="blue" VLINK="blue" ALINK="blue" BGCOLOR="white">
24.00 
 
25.00 
 <table width="600">
26.00 
 <tr><td><table width="100%" cellspacing="0" cellpadding="0">
27.00 
         <tr><td valign=top><img src="/cgicbldev2/graphics/pears.gif"
28.00 
                 alt="Giovanni's logo"></td>
29.00 
             <td valign=middle>
30.00 
                 <div class=title>
31.00 
                 Example of using subprocedure QRANDOMSTRING
32.00 
                 </div>
33.00 
                 </td>
34.00 
             <td valign=middle><img src="/cgicbldev2/graphics/v2.gif"
35.00 
                 alt="this means Version 2">
36.00 
         </td></tr>
37.00 
         <tr><td colspan=3>
38.00 
                 <table width="100%" cellspacing="0" cellpadding="0">
39.00 
                 <tr><td width="100%">
40.00 
                         <img src="/cgicbldev2/graphics/blue.gif" alt="blue line" border="0"
41.00 
                              height="1" width="100%">
42.00 
                         </td></tr>
43.00 
                 </table>
44.00 
                 </td></tr>
45.00 
         </table>
46.00 
         </td></tr>
47.00 
 </table>
48.00 
 <br><br>
49.00 
 /$badlen
50.00 
 <div class=reg><b>String length "/%stringLenC%/" not numeric!</b></div><br><br>
51.00 
 /$case1
52.00 
 <form name=form1 method=get  action="/cgicbldev2p/randomstrg.pgm">
53.00 
 <input type=hidden name=request value=x>
54.00 
 <table width=600>
55.00 
 <tr><td colspan=3><h3>Generate a random string made as follow:</h3></td></tr>
56.00 
     <th align=left>length</th><th align=left>first character</th><th align=left>remaining characters</th>
57.00 
 <tr><td><input type=text name=stringLenC size=2 maxlength=2 value="/%stringLenC%/"></td>
58.00 
     <td><select name=firstChar>
59.00 
         <option value="*upperLetter" /%sltfchar1%/>*upperLetter
60.00 
         <option value="*lowerLetter" /%sltfchar2%/>*lowerLetter
61.00 
         <option value="*mixedLetter" /%sltfchar3%/>*mixedLetter
62.00 
         <option value="*upperDigit"  /%sltfchar4%/>*upperDigit
63.00 
         <option value="*lowerDigit"  /%sltfchar5%/>*lowerDigit
64.00 
         <option value="*mixedDigit"  /%sltfchar6%/>*mixedDigit
65.00 
         <option value="*digit"       /%sltfchar7%/>*digit
66.00 
         </select></td>
67.00 
     <td><select name=remainChar>
68.00 
         <option value="*upperLetter" /%sltrchar1%/>*upperLetter
69.00 
         <option value="*lowerLetter" /%sltrchar2%/>*lowerLetter
70.00 
         <option value="*mixedLetter" /%sltrchar3%/>*mixedLetter
71.00 
         <option value="*upperDigit"  /%sltrchar4%/>*upperDigit
72.00 
         <option value="*lowerDigit"  /%sltrchar5%/>*lowerDigit
73.00 
         <option value="*mixedDigit"  /%sltrchar6%/>*mixedDigit
74.00 
         <option value="*digit"       /%sltrchar7%/>*digit
75.00 
         </select></td></tr>
76.00 
 <tr><td align=center colspan=3><br>
77.00 
         <input type=submit value="go">
78.00 
         </td></tr>
79.00 
 </table></form>
80.00 
 /$case2
81.00 
 <table width=600>
82.00 
 <tr><td align=center>
83.00 
         <div class=reg>The following random string has been generated:</div>
84.00 
         <table border=1><tr><td class=mono>/%randomString%/</td></tr></table>
85.00 
         </td></tr>
86.00 
 </table>
87.00 
 /$end
88.00 
 <br><br>
89.00 
 <table width="600">
90.00 
 <tr><td><a href="/cgicbldev2p/dspsrc.cgi?srclib=cgicbldev2&srcfile=htmlexampl&srcmbr=randomstrg"
91.00 
          target="_blank"><b>Display the external html source</b></a></td>
92.00 
     <td align=right>
93.00 
         <a href="/cgicbldev2p/dspsrc.cgi?srclib=cgicbldev2&srcfile=qcbllesrc&srcmbr=randomstrg"
94.00 
          target="_blank"><b>Display the COBOL source</b></a></td>
95.00 
         </td></tr>
96.00 
 </table>
97.00 
 </BODY></HTML>
0.040 sec.s